Ulysses couldn't capitalize on their home-field advantage in their season opener. They took a blow against the Colby Eagles on Friday, falling 39-6. The Tigers' defeat continues a trend for the squad, making it ten in a row dating back to last season.
Tyce Perez threw for 130 yards and a touchdown.
Joel Guaderrama was his top target, rushing for 76 yards, while also picking up 45 receiving yards.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Ulysses will square off against Hugoton at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. As for Colby, they are taking a road trip to take on Holyoke at 7:00 p.m. on Friday.
